The backbone of Italian food is tomato sauce, or "sugo" in Italian. Sugo is used in everything from pasta to pizza, and no Italian kitchen is complete without a large pot of sugo boiling on the stove.

You'll need excellent San Marzano tomatoes, extra-virgin olive oil, garlic, and a few other simple ingredients to prepare classic tomato sauce. Allowing the flavors to mingle and deepen for hours is the secret to making a delicious tomato sauce.

Pesto

Pesto is another traditional Italian sauce that is quite adaptable. Pesto is typically eaten with pasta but may also be used as a pizza topping or as a salad dressing. It is made with fresh basil, pine nuts, garlic, and Parmigiano-Reggiano cheese or as a bread dip.

To prepare classic pesto, first roast the pine nuts until golden brown. Next in a food processor & combine them with the basil & garlic & cheese & gently pouring in the olive oil until the pesto is smooth.

Risotto

Risotto is a creamy rice dish that is popular in northern Italy. It may be cooked with a number of ingredients such as mushrooms & asparagus & shellfish But the Most Traditional form uses saffron.

To begin making classic saffron risotto, toast the rice in a skillet with butter and onion. Next, add the white wine and heat until the liquid has been absorbed. Next, add a little chicken or veggie broth at a time, , continually tossing, until the rice is done but still has a firm bite. Lastly, for a rich, creamy finish, add saffron and Parmigiano-Reggiano cheese.

Tiramisu

Tiramisu is a traditional Italian dessert composed with espresso & mascarpone and ladyfingers. It's rich and decadent, making it the ideal way to conclude a meal.

To prepare traditional tiramisu, pour a strong cup of espresso and set it aside to cool. Next, mix the egg yolks and sugar together until light and fluffy. Separately, whip the egg whites until stiff peaks form. Stir the egg whites into the yolk mixture, then stir in the mascarpone cheese until smooth.

Dip the ladyfingers in the cooled espresso and put them in the tiramisu In a dish, arrange the ingredients in a single layer. Pour a layer of the mascarpone mixture over the ladyfingers, then repeat with the other ingredients. Refrigerate the tiramisu for several hours before serving.

The History of Italian Cuisine

The history of Italian food is extensive and intriguing. It may be traced back to ancient Rome, when the elite ate elaborate feasts and the poor ate plain foods like bread and vegetables. With the fall of the Roman Empire, different countries entered Italy, each bringing their unique cooking traditions and ingredients. This resulted in the development of new dishes and regional cuisines.

Italy's regional cuisine

Each of Italy's 20 regions has its own set of traditional foods and Specialities. Tuscany, for example, is famed for its bean and vegetable soups, whilst Sicily is recognized for its seafood meals. Each location has distinct tastes, ingredients, and cooking methods.

Pizza is another iconic Italian dish that has spread around the world. Simple ingredients like tomato sauce, mozzarella cheese, and fresh basil are used to make Italian pizza. It's baked in a wood-fired oven, which gives it a crispy exterior and great taste.

Wines and drinks from Italy

Italian wines are among the greatest in the world, and they pair perfectly with Italian cuisine. Italian wines span from Chianti to Barolo in terms of variety and flavor. Cocktails from Italy, such as the Negroni and Aperol Spritz, are also popular across the world.
